[ 5.0 ms ] story [ 16.5 ms ] threadIf I was buying new, I would go for an 13" MBA with 8G RAM. The i7 upgrade is nice to have but not essential. As for storage I would settle for 256G SSD and use a USB3 external drive for backup and non-active storage.
For me: The 11" MBA screen is a bit small and battery life a bit limited. The MacBook keyboard bothers me and the 12" screen feels smallish too. My eyes are not that good, so the Retina screens don't make that much difference. YMMV.
